Reject empty field *only if on layout*

Hi All

Five year member; first post!

My database has >1000 fields and hundreds of layouts. In 12 years of running this database, I've not been able to overcome the following (apparently simple) problem and I've decided to put some effort into trying to crack it.

On most layouts, I require each field to be completed and I'd like some validation to check this is the case. However, all layouts only contain a small fraction of possible fields, say 50 on each one. I only want to check that the fields which are present on the layout are completed/not empty. I've been messing with 'validation by calculation' but I don't see a simple way of doing this.

I'm rather fascinated that this does not seem to be an issue for most people as I would have thought this would be reasonably common requirement but lots of searching around suggests this is not the case.

I'd be very grateful for any help.
